SHS VOLLEYBALL (NLI) SIGNING – A Sheridan high school volleyball player will play at least two more years, but on the other side of the Big Horn mountains, Brooke Larsen has signed her letter on intent to play at Northwest college in Powell
Brooke says it was the only place that reached out to her and she’s been there before.
And she added she’s been playing volleyball since she was about 5 years old, and the sport runs in the family.
Brooke says she thinking about majoring in Pre-Nursing.
SHS WINTER SPORTS – The full winter sports season is underway with track and field starting Saturday in Gillette.
We sat down with Sheridan high school Activities Director Casey Garnhart , he says indoor track numbers are outstanding once again.
And he said the addition of Nordic skiing and Lady Bronc wrestling gives more students a chance to compete.
